Examples
你能给我提供一些建议吗?
everydayCan you provide me with some advice?
该公司提供高质量的售后服务。
formalThe company provides high-quality after-sales service.
这儿不提供免费水。
informalFree water is not provided here.
本研究为政策制定提供了理论依据。
academicThis study provided a theoretical basis for policy making.
我们将提供最优惠的价格。
businessWe will provide the most favorable price.
Word Family
Common Collocations
Common Phrases
由...提供
provided by...
提供证据
provide evidence
提供资金
provide funding
Often Confused With
供应 (supply) is often used for goods/commodities; 提供 is broader and used for services, help, or abstract things.
Usage Notes
A high-frequency verb in IELTS writing for discussing what governments or schools should 'provide'.
Common Mistakes
Sometimes confused with '提出' (to propose).
Memory Tip
提 (to carry/bring) + 供 (to supply/offer) = bringing something to offer to others.
Word Origin
From '提' (bring forward) and '供' (offer).
